<h2>Answer:</h2>

If x represents time, the average rate of change of the function f(x) in the first three seconds is  40.

<h2>Step-by-step explanation:</h2>

We know that the average rate of change which is also know as a slope of a function from x=a to x=b is calculated by the formula:

                    Rate\ of\ change=\dfrac{f(b)-f(a)}{b-a}

Here we are asked to find the average rate of change between x=0 to x=3 ( i.e. in the first three seconds)

It is calculated as follows:

Rate\ of\ change=\dfrac{f(3)-f(0)}{3-0}\\\\\\Rate\ of\ change=\dfrac{220-100}{3}\\\\\\Rate\ of\ change=\dfrac{120}{3}\\\\\\Rate\ of\ change=40
